FAQ: First-aid room access. Location: ground floor, behind the Hallowick Atrium lifts. Open it for any staff member or visitor on request; no sign-off needed. Log the visit in the reception book afterwards. Restock requests go to the Pellam facilities queue. The door locks automatically. Enter the keypad code listed below to open it.

door code, yagap-bahof: bdg-O-05

## Scheduler API

Nightbloom runs nightly data backfills for the Carrowgate warehouse. Jobs are declared as YAML specs and submitted to the scheduler endpoint; retries and windowing are handled automatically. Contractors get a scoped credential limited to the backfill namespace, which cannot touch production streams. Submit specs with a POST to the jobs route, authenticating each request with the key below.

gateway credential: kto23_LX9A4ys6i4nzHtpOLNLodKK

Meeting notes — Thursday standup, Verrolab dispatch sync

Quick recap for the desk: the M2-class calibration weights from the Orvane batch passed re-check yesterday, so Petra's team boxed them in the padded crates, not the usual trays. They're heavier than they look, so flag the courier for a two-person lift at the dock. Marek wants them out before noon Friday, no exceptions this time. One more thing before the run gets scheduled — the hand-over instruction for the courier is below.

courier memo of tawep-tajep: the quenius ulaiel courier leaves the fenir ledger at gate 9128 under passcode 527513

Finance Review Summary — Gross Margin

Q2 gross margin landed at 38.4%, down 2.1 points. Drivers: input cost inflation on the Kestrel line, freight surcharges, and discount creep in mid-market deals. Mitigations underway: supplier renegotiation and a pricing floor effective next quarter. Heads of department should flag exceptions weekly. Directional guidance for the coming year follows below.

internal memo for kawip-hadug: Headcount on the Wenwyn team goes from 7 to 140 by the end of January. Gross margin on Wenwyn came in at 20 percent against a plan of 15 percent.